摘要
Educating for students in accounting major in universities nowadays become one of key components of training programs in economic programs in economic universities in Asia and the world, including Vietnam. This study mainly use qualitative scientific methods including synthesis, inductive and explanatory methods, combined with dialectical materialism methods The research findings tell us that students in accounting major need to be educated and equipped with quantitative model and analysis skills, hence we propose a case study as an example of case teaching method. Besides, it is necessary for us to propose suggestions for enhancing educational policies for universities in educating students in accounting or finance major.
